Frequently Asked Questions about Mechanicsville

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Mechanicsville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Mechanicsville ranges from $726 to $2,550 with an average monthly rent of $1,618.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Mechanicsville c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Mechanicsville range from $995 to $2,865.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,634.

How expensive are Mechanicsville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 23 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Mechanicsville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,395 to $3,295 - averaging $1,851 for the location.
